summ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orDavid Runge2023-02-06 10:38:31 +0000
committerDavid Runge2023-02-06 10:38:31 +0000
commit86b9ca23a7b612e847916d00665e576e0fcaa7c3 (patch)
treec84b21e6533c9ad62c00e41183f9887b788c7e6e
parent1d218d74f9afe8f203f21f3b77f60020a3f20047 (diff)
downloadaur-86b9ca23a7b612e847916d00665e576e0fcaa7c3.tar.gz
Upgrade to 1.1.1.
-rw-r--r--PKGBUILD14
-rw-r--r--python-pdm-pep517-1.1.1-devendor.patch (renamed from python-pdm-pep517-1.0.5-devendor.patch)46
2 files changed, 29 insertions, 31 deletions
diff --git a/PKGBUILD b/PKGBUILD
index f57d81b52f15..c5398a12be20 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-6,7 +6,7 @@ _name=pdm-pep517
pkgname=python-pdm-pep517
# WARNING: python-pdm may not be compatible with whatever pdm-pep517 can be upgraded to:
# https://github.com/pdm-project/pdm/issues/1165
-pkgver=1.0.6
+pkgver=1.1.1
pkgrel=1
epoch=1
pkgdesc="A PEP 517 backend for PDM that supports PEP 621 metadata"
@@ -31,16 +31,16 @@ optdepends=(
)
source=(
https://files.pythonhosted.org/packages/source/${_name::1}/$_name/$_name-$pkgver.tar.gz
- $pkgname-1.0.5-devendor.patch
+ $pkgname-1.1.1-devendor.patch
)
-sha512sums=('b09a33a2e3470266d00a0e3fae2fdb59e5404ef891c50efe87805a0b7df85ca75d29a37c747510d5481dcebd5f99abceb49f09155e54218072bc54457fc4a333'
- '0158c486ebb668b7e48b450d50a8223d45776517e868dd85c322d29cd925acd3e2e28782796a16e137dcc38312bce753535ba7c71ced58f8d5dd74ddb41701c0')
-b2sums=('b38c770b9bada5747017e173e7f6e277b736b6b03204b17ab34184e5bfa2acdcb6b03d2001944c37d35638c3446f4262b1c823e93d3a36d35b2446c8a01f5377'
- '4b20b48d9eeac1bb397eec1c98400a9f70aa576689c1cefb33e31dd86f128f30c51be759bb8ede3a2c26ec65055020e3decee7d1b42d67720902db9e6b13cd42')
+sha512sums=('f374ad13f1f06228956b5cfa8a8da455e80b31c68d33ceddbeb3e90925ff3bb4dd8d20dc037a99768490c4d44f38ebe119709ec261ec55c3f38c720747079ba3'
+ 'ab03d3dc4beb3a3530a1f14fb2f1eeef6c34f7a768b02312ccdc50e50c58f68a04b30a38af7bdbba2a8242131e5ef7451be54c6c3ab2146912eb3ae15fca4369')
+b2sums=('4e6557278275c73bd0c26b20a793e57894481d6bba23b57ca350cee064adfbb82bd303fa6e69de86ee35deab55ed56d7c9c70c6d7ce66b8f29dbe2f1ff867a01'
+ '0c286fd2b69c6d499b54779d964d3267ca8f9392cdbbfcdb3a079f9ea26496fe58e4a8f97e4032941d545297fe02192ec49b8a6c39ed2eaec0bc9001a35285da')
prepare() {
if (( $_devendored == 1 )); then
- patch -Np1 -d $_name-$pkgver -i ../$pkgname-1.0.5-devendor.patch
+ patch -Np1 -d $_name-$pkgver -i ../$pkgname-1.1.1-devendor.patch
rm -frv $_name-$pkgver/pdm/pep517/_vendor
fi
}
diff --git a/python-pdm-pep517-1.0.5-devendor.patch b/python-pdm-pep517-1.1.1-devendor.patch
index b8637dd0af8e..b0997f8a8959 100644
--- a/python-pdm-pep517-1.0.5-devendor.patch
+++ b/python-pdm-pep517-1.1.1-devendor.patch
@@ -1,6 +1,6 @@
diff -ruN a/pdm/pep517/base.py b/pdm/pep517/base.py
---- a/pdm/pep517/base.py 2022-10-24 04:00:28.909448900 +0200
-+++ b/pdm/pep517/base.py 2022-10-31 19:03:59.193340376 +0100
+--- a/pdm/pep517/base.py 2023-01-30 09:16:32.496682600 +0100
++++ b/pdm/pep517/base.py 2023-02-06 11:21:13.921707644 +0100
@@ -7,7 +7,7 @@
from pathlib import Path
from typing import Any, Iterator, Mapping, TypeVar, cast
@@ -11,8 +11,8 @@ diff -ruN a/pdm/pep517/base.py b/pdm/pep517/base.py
from pdm.pep517.metadata import Metadata
from pdm.pep517.utils import is_python_package, safe_version, to_filename
diff -ruN a/pdm/pep517/license.py b/pdm/pep517/license.py
---- a/pdm/pep517/license.py 2022-10-24 04:00:28.909448900 +0200
-+++ b/pdm/pep517/license.py 2022-10-31 19:03:59.193340376 +0100
+--- a/pdm/pep517/license.py 2023-01-30 09:16:32.496682600 +0100
++++ b/pdm/pep517/license.py 2023-02-06 11:21:43.308517776 +0100
@@ -1,6 +1,6 @@
import warnings
@@ -22,8 +22,8 @@ diff -ruN a/pdm/pep517/license.py b/pdm/pep517/license.py
Licensing,
get_spdx_licensing,
diff -ruN a/pdm/pep517/metadata.py b/pdm/pep517/metadata.py
---- a/pdm/pep517/metadata.py 2022-10-24 04:00:28.909448900 +0200
-+++ b/pdm/pep517/metadata.py 2022-10-31 19:21:03.621468652 +0100
+--- a/pdm/pep517/metadata.py 2023-01-30 09:16:32.496682600 +0100
++++ b/pdm/pep517/metadata.py 2023-02-06 11:22:31.348744924 +0100
@@ -5,7 +5,7 @@
from pathlib import Path
from typing import Any, Callable, Generic, Iterable, Mapping, TypeVar, cast
@@ -34,22 +34,20 @@ diff -ruN a/pdm/pep517/metadata.py b/pdm/pep517/metadata.py
from pdm.pep517.utils import (
cd,
diff -ruN a/pdm/pep517/scm.py b/pdm/pep517/scm.py
---- a/pdm/pep517/scm.py 2022-10-24 04:00:28.909448900 +0200
-+++ b/pdm/pep517/scm.py 2022-10-31 19:03:59.193340376 +0100
-@@ -14,8 +14,8 @@
+--- a/pdm/pep517/scm.py 2023-01-30 09:16:32.496682600 +0100
++++ b/pdm/pep517/scm.py 2023-02-06 11:22:58.088867697 +0100
+@@ -14,7 +14,7 @@
from pathlib import Path
from typing import Any, Iterable, NamedTuple
--from pdm.pep517._vendor.packaging.version import LegacyVersion, Version
--from pdm.pep517._vendor.packaging.version import parse as parse_version
-+from packaging.version import LegacyVersion, Version
-+from packaging.version import parse as parse_version
+-from pdm.pep517._vendor.packaging.version import Version
++from packaging.version import Version
DEFAULT_TAG_REGEX = re.compile(
r"^(?:[\w-]+-)?(?P<version>[vV]?\d+(?:\.\d+){0,2}[^\+]*)(?:\+.*)?$"
diff -ruN a/pdm/pep517/sdist.py b/pdm/pep517/sdist.py
---- a/pdm/pep517/sdist.py 2022-10-24 04:00:28.909448900 +0200
-+++ b/pdm/pep517/sdist.py 2022-10-31 19:03:59.193340376 +0100
+--- a/pdm/pep517/sdist.py 2023-01-30 09:16:32.496682600 +0100
++++ b/pdm/pep517/sdist.py 2023-02-06 11:23:41.209060527 +0100
@@ -6,7 +6,8 @@
from copy import copy
from typing import Any, Iterator
@@ -61,8 +59,8 @@ diff -ruN a/pdm/pep517/sdist.py b/pdm/pep517/sdist.py
diff -ruN a/pdm/pep517/utils.py b/pdm/pep517/utils.py
---- a/pdm/pep517/utils.py 2022-10-24 04:00:28.909448900 +0200
-+++ b/pdm/pep517/utils.py 2022-10-31 19:21:55.245026206 +0100
+--- a/pdm/pep517/utils.py 2023-01-30 09:16:32.496682600 +0100
++++ b/pdm/pep517/utils.py 2023-02-06 11:25:52.322945698 +0100
@@ -12,10 +12,10 @@
from pathlib import Path
from typing import Callable, Generator, Iterable, Match
@@ -79,8 +77,8 @@ diff -ruN a/pdm/pep517/utils.py b/pdm/pep517/utils.py
diff -ruN a/pdm/pep517/validator.py b/pdm/pep517/validator.py
---- a/pdm/pep517/validator.py 2022-10-24 04:00:28.909448900 +0200
-+++ b/pdm/pep517/validator.py 2022-10-31 19:03:59.196673721 +0100
+--- a/pdm/pep517/validator.py 2023-01-30 09:16:32.496682600 +0100
++++ b/pdm/pep517/validator.py 2023-02-06 11:26:08.483010544 +0100
@@ -1,6 +1,6 @@
from typing import Mapping
@@ -90,9 +88,9 @@ diff -ruN a/pdm/pep517/validator.py b/pdm/pep517/validator.py
README_RULE = [
diff -ruN a/pdm/pep517/wheel.py b/pdm/pep517/wheel.py
---- a/pdm/pep517/wheel.py 2022-10-24 04:00:28.909448900 +0200
-+++ b/pdm/pep517/wheel.py 2022-10-31 19:03:59.196673721 +0100
-@@ -19,8 +19,8 @@
+--- a/pdm/pep517/wheel.py 2023-01-30 09:16:32.496682600 +0100
++++ b/pdm/pep517/wheel.py 2023-02-06 11:26:34.226445919 +0100
+@@ -20,8 +20,8 @@
from typing import Any, BinaryIO, Generator, Mapping, NamedTuple, TextIO
from pdm.pep517 import __version__
@@ -104,8 +102,8 @@ diff -ruN a/pdm/pep517/wheel.py b/pdm/pep517/wheel.py
from pdm.pep517.exceptions import BuildError, PDMWarning
from pdm.pep517.utils import get_abi_tag, get_platform, show_warning
diff -ruN a/tests/test_metadata.py b/tests/test_metadata.py
---- a/tests/test_metadata.py 2022-10-24 04:00:28.913448800 +0200
-+++ b/tests/test_metadata.py 2022-10-31 19:03:59.196673721 +0100
+--- a/tests/test_metadata.py 2023-01-30 09:16:32.500682800 +0100
++++ b/tests/test_metadata.py 2023-02-06 11:27:08.173244829 +0100
@@ -5,7 +5,7 @@
import pytest